My decimal to binary converter will tell you that, in pure binary, 129.95 has an infinite repeating fraction: 10000001.111100110011001100110011001100110011001100110011, Rounded to the 53 bits of double-precision, its, 10000001.11110011001100110011001100110011001100110011. which is 129.94999999999998863131622783839702606201171875 in decimal. Decimal to floating-point conversion introduces inexactness because a decimal operand may not have an exact floating-point equivalent; limited-precision binary arithmetic introduces inexactness because a binary calculation may produce more bits than can be stored.
